The State of DevOps annual reports have shown beyond doubt that the application of DevOps can help IT organisations release better software faster.
The ninth edition of the annual encyclopaedic review of worldwide DevOps practices, has shed light on what makes a successful, high-performing DevOps organisation:
- A platform approach to software delivery – the platform model has proven itself integral to faster, more efficient delivery of high-quality software. Organisations who employ it can respond quickly to the demands of the organisation’s business needs, and at scale
- Applying DevOps principles to change management – using DevOps to relieve the bottleneck of change management helps software to be released at pace and at the quality and security level the organisation requires.
